What is the solution of -(x + 1) - 5 > 10

Mathematics
2 answers:
Pie3 years ago
6 0
<span> -(x + 1) - 5 > 10
 -x - 1 - 5 > 10
 - x - 6 > 10
Add 6 to the both sides, 
-x - 6 + 6 > 10 + 6
-x > 16
x < -16  [ changed sign 'cause changed -sign ]

In short, Your Answer would be x < -16

How many ways can three different numbers be selected from 10 numbers to open a keypad lock?
Paraphin [41]

There are 720 ways through which 3 numbers can be selected from 10 numbers to open a keypad lock.

Given that there are 10 numbers are 3 numbers are required to open a keypad lock.

Permutations are the number of ways in which objects can be selected without replacements to form subsets.

It is expressed as nP_{r}=n!/(n-r)!.

Factorial of a number is the product of consecutive numbers less than the number.

Total numbers available=10

Numbers to be selected=3

Number of ways can be found by using permutations.

Number of ways =10P_{3}

=10!/(10-3)!

=10!/7!

=10*9*8*7!/7!

=10*9*8

=720 ways.

Hence there are 720 ways through which 3 numbers can be selected from 10 numbers.
